In my family, holidays—especially New Year’s Day—are more than just dates on the calendar. They’re moments wrapped in tradition, laughter, and most importantly, food.
We don’t really make any special dish. But, our signature dish? Pounded yam with either vegetable soup or egusi soup (you’ll def relate to this if you’re Nigerian). It’s not just a meal—it’s an experience. The rhythmic pounding of the yam, the rich aroma of simmering spices, the vibrant colors of the soup… it all builds anticipation before the first bite. 😋
On New Year’s Day, the whole house smells of home. Conversations flow as freely as the soups bubble on the stove. It’s how we welcome the year, after dedicating it to God—warm, united, and thankful.
If you’ve never had pounded yam with egusi or vegetable soup, you’re missing out on a feast that feeds both body and soul.

After a long period of time, I decided to make a research on what could be done to relieve cramps, apart from drugs. Then, i found out some home remedies for cramps, and I thought it wise to share some of them to you.
So, ladies, pay attention and read to end 😌:
1. Apply heat: This is done by placing heating pad or a portable hot water flask to your lower abdomen.
Heating pad relieves aches, pains, cramps and muscle inflexibility. (Available on Amazon.com, Jumia and the likes)
Alternatively, you can take a hot bath. However, the heat must not be extreme so as not to cause discomfort.
2. Abstain from junky treats: Chocolate bars, ice-creams, yoghurts and the likes are sweet but worsen cramps.
3. Instead of carbonated drinks, try herbal teas like ginger tea, cinnamon tea, thyme tea, etc. They reduce cramps too.
For ginger tea, you can drink it for three consecutive days before your menstrual period. You will realise that you feel less or no pain at all, and will be able to do your normal activities with ease.
4. Avoid spicy foods: Spicy foods burn and hurt our mouths, but also aggravate cramps. Try eating fruits like bananas, lemons, watermelons.
PS: When on periods, do not eat cucumber for its saps block the blood from flowing.
5. Engage in less-stressful activities.
6. Yoga and meditation help too. You’ll feel relaxed and serene. If you don’t believe me, a trial or two will convince you.
